At 135m, The Merlin Entertainments London Eye is the worldÂ’s largest cantilevered observation wheel. It was conceived and designed by Marks Barfield Architects and was launched in 2000. It has already won over 75 awards for national and international tourism, outstanding architectural quality and engineering achievement and has now welcomed over 30 million visitors. For ...
